Output 66a6346a5578746f37d625014eb8049b2eac534351f5c593811e96819a5dc6e4:1

value
462772
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1daa1830228f71b6ef261e7d9b06b5c8dc165fd8bafe776cc0e185e3e095df1d
address
tb1prk4psvpz3acmdmexre7ekp44erwpvh7chtl8wmxquxz78cy4muws0xt402
transaction
66a6346a5578746f37d625014eb8049b2eac534351f5c593811e96819a5dc6e4
confirmations
63856
spent
true